About NexGen Cloud & Hyperstack

We are a fast-growing company building next-generation GPU cloud infrastructure.

NexGen Cloud is the company behind Hyperstack, a cloud platform providing on-demand and private cloud infrastructure for high-performance workloads. Hyperstack is used by teams running compute-heavy applications that require speed, reliability, and control.

Our platform enables enterprises, research teams and AI-native companies to train, deploy and scale AI models using flexible GPU infrastructure.

What you need to know about the London Tech Scene

London isn't just a hub for established businesses; it's also a nursery for innovation. Boasting one of the most recognized fintech ecosystems in Europe, attracting billions in investments each year, London's success has made it a go-to destination for startups looking to make their mark. Top U.K. companies like Hoptin, Moneybox and Marshmallow have already made the city their base — yet fintech is just the beginning. From healthtech to renewable energy to cybersecurity and beyond, the city's startups are breaking new ground across a range of industries.
